Details
-
Bug
-
Status: Resolved
-
Major
-
Resolution: Won't Fix
-
1.0.1
-
None
Description
Today http://castor.org was down, and when I attempted to deploy a portlet using 'maven deploy' I crashed and burned:
[esm@clue pluto-descriptor-fixes]$ tomcat clean msel-eres-webapp ; maven -Ddeploy=/home/esm/workspace/EreservesPortlet/msel-eres-webapp/target/msel-eres-webapp.war deploy
Done.
__ __
\/ | __ Apache_ ___ | |||||
\/ | / ` \ V / -) ' \ ~ intelligent projects ~ | |||||
_ | _,_ | _/___ | _ | _ | v. 1.0.2 |
---|
build:start:
deploy:
[echo]
************************************************
- Please ensure that a fullDeployment has *
- previously been run if this deploy attempt *
- fails. It is the fullDeployment that *
- deploys pluto container and portal driver. *
************************************************
Starting the reactor...
Our processing order:
Pluto Portlet Deployment
+----------------------------------------
Deploy a portlet Pluto Portlet Deployment |
Memory: 2M/4M +---------------------------------------- build:start: |
deploy:
[java] <VERBOSE> Source WebApp: /home/esm/workspace/EreservesPortlet/msel-eres-webapp/target/msel-eres-webapp.war
[java] <VERBOSE> Destination: /home/esm/tc55/webapps
[java] <VERBOSE> Portal WebApp: /home/esm/tc55/webapps/pluto
[java] <VERBOSE> Portlet Context: /home/esm/tc55/webapps/msel-eres-webapp
[java] java.net.ConnectException: Connection refused
[java] at java.net.PlainSocketImpl.socketConnect(Native Method)
[java] at java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:305)
[java] at java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:171)
[java] at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:158)
[java] at java.net.Socket.connect(Socket.java:452)
[java] at java.net.Socket.connect(Socket.java:402)
[java] at sun.net.NetworkClient.doConnect(NetworkClient.java:139)
[java] at sun.net.www.http.HttpClient.openServer(HttpClient.java:402)
[java] at sun.net.www.http.HttpClient.openServer(HttpClient.java:618)
[java] at sun.net.www.http.HttpClient.<init>(HttpClient.java:306)
[java] at sun.net.www.http.HttpClient.<init>(HttpClient.java:267)
[java] at sun.net.www.http.HttpClient.New(HttpClient.java:339)
[java] at sun.net.www.http.HttpClient.New(HttpClient.java:320)
[java] at sun.net.www.http.HttpClient.New(HttpClient.java:315)
[java] at sun.net.www.protocol.http.HttpURLConnection.plainConnect(HttpURLConnection.java:521)
[java] at sun.net.www.protocol.http.HttpURLConnection.connect(HttpURLConnection.java:498)
[java] at s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:626)
[java] at java.net.URL.openStream(URL.java:913)
[java] at org.exolab.castor.util.DTDResolver.resolveEntity(DTDResolver.java:249)
[java] at org.apache.xerces.util.EntityResolverWrapper.resolveEntity(Unknown Source)
[java] at org.apache.xerces.impl.XMLEntityManager.resolveEntity(Unknown Source)
[java] at org.apache.xerces.impl.XMLDocumentScannerImpl$DTDDispatcher.dispatch(Unknown Source)
[java] at org.apache.xerces.impl.XMLDocumentFragmentScannerImpl.scanDocument(Unknown Source)
[java] at org.apache.xerces.parsers.DTDConfiguration.parse(Unknown Source)
[java] at org.apache.xerces.parsers.DTDConfiguration.parse(Unknown Source)
[java] at org.apache.xerces.parsers.XMLParser.parse(Unknown Source)
[java] at org.apache.xerces.parsers.AbstractSAXParser.parse(Unknown Source)
[java] at org.exolab.castor.xml.Unmarshaller.unmarshal(Unmarshaller.java:605)
[java] at org.exolab.castor.mapping.Mapping.loadMappingInternal(Mapping.java:532)
[java] at org.exolab.castor.mapping.Mapping.loadMapping(Mapping.java:435)
[java] at org.apache.pluto.descriptors.services.impl.AbstractWebAppDescriptorService.getCastorMapping(AbstractWebAppDescriptorService.java:134)
[java] at org.apache.pluto.descriptors.services.impl.AbstractCastorDescriptorService.readInternal(AbstractCastorDescriptorService.java:66)
[java] at org.apache.pluto.descriptors.services.impl.AbstractWebAppDescriptorService.read(AbstractWebAppDescriptorService.java:77)
[java] at org.apache.pluto.driver.deploy.Deploy.updateDescriptors(Deploy.java:142)
[java] at org.apache.pluto.driver.deploy.Deploy.deploy(Deploy.java:130)
[java] at org.apache.pluto.driver.deploy.CLI.main(CLI.java:59)
[java] Exception in thread "main" java.io.IOException: Nested error: java.net.ConnectException: Connection refused
[java] at org.apache.pluto.descriptors.services.impl.AbstractCastorDescriptorService.readInternal(AbstractCastorDescriptorService.java:77)
[java] at org.apache.pluto.descriptors.services.impl.AbstractWebAppDescriptorService.read(AbstractWebAppDescriptorService.java:77)
[java] at org.apache.pluto.driver.deploy.Deploy.updateDescriptors(Deploy.java:142)
[java] at org.apache.pluto.driver.deploy.Deploy.deploy(Deploy.java:130)
[java] at org.apache.pluto.driver.deploy.CLI.main(CLI.java:59)
[java] [ERROR] Java Result: 1
BUILD SUCCESSFUL
Total time: 3 seconds
Finished at: Thu May 18 14:54:16 EDT 2006